百科问答小站 logo
百科问答小站 font logo



linux的TCP连接数量最大不能超过65535个,那服务器是如何应对百万千万的并发的? 第1页

  

user avatar   rocwon 网友的相关建议: 
      

跟端口没关系,你应该修改file-max, nr-open这些参数,增加文件描述符的数量,让系统/进程能接受更多的连接请求,免得报too many open files错误。

还有就是,对并发存在误解。

1000TPS,并不是1000个tcp connection,而是你的系统每秒钟能处理1000个transaction,哪怕你只用了5个connection。




  

相关话题

  你碰到过的最难调试的 Bug 是什么样的? 
  转行去日本从事计算机工作现实吗? 
  如何反驳「Powershell 比 Linux shell(bash..)好得多」这种说法? 
  怎样让自己的 PC 拥有强大的功能和极高的效率? 
  微内核鸿蒙OS 2.0是如何做到不使用Linux和安卓代码同时又兼容Linux和安卓的呢? 
  为什么国内互联网公司喜欢用Centos而不是Ubuntu/Debian? 
  晾一件刚洗的衣服,有可能计算出每滴水落地的时间间隔吗? 
  电脑打补丁会导致机器很慢,可以不打补丁吗? 
  目前计算机能精确计算小数了么? 
  如何扎实系统地学好后端开发(Linux 环境下)?细分方向有哪些?可否推荐一些好的开源项目? 

前一个讨论
问了医生病是怎么导致的,但是医生都不重视这个问题,他们都比较重视病情如何,是不是所有医生都这样?
下一个讨论
如何评价苹果 macOS Big Sur?





© 2024-09-19 - tinynew.org. All Rights Reserved.
© 2024-09-19 - tinynew.org. 保留所有权利